Yes, the main advantage of Advanced "Storage" Techniques is the extra cultural centers. The extra population and cargo space are also very helpful, though.
Adjusting the population effects around the usual starting population levels is a good idea. There are sixty entries in the Proportions mod population curve, so it is pretty smooth, but it would make sense to smooth out the parts near the starting homeworld population levels. I had rationalized it as an effect of mobilizing your homeworld population for colonial expansion, but perhaps the ~9% effect is too great. The only problem is it's a nuisance to insert values in the sequence. Maybe I'll write a program to do it. The insect idea is a nice one. My design for Foundations mod has a more developed insectoid tech tree with several groovy items, but I'm currently taking a break from working on major mods. PvK |

You do realize that it is the TOTAL cost that has to be no more than 50% greater, not individual resource costs, right? A 10000/100/2000 cost spaceyard can be retrofit to a 5000/8000/2000 cost spaceyard, no problem. |
